Optimal Light Conditions for Outdoor Growth

🌞 Sunlight Exposure

Hydrangea 'Pinky Winky' thrives in a range of light conditions, from partial shade to full sun. Aim for 4-6 hours of direct sunlight daily to keep your plant healthy and vibrant.

Excessive sunlight can lead to leaf scorch and wilting, so it's crucial to monitor your plant's exposure. If you notice signs of stress, consider providing some afternoon shade.

πŸ’‘ Light Intensity

Light intensity plays a significant role in the overall health and flowering of your hydrangea. Higher light levels generally promote more robust blooms.

To measure light intensity accurately, use a light meter. This tool helps you determine if your plant is getting the right amount of light.

Effects of Light on Flowering

🌸 Flowering Relationship

Adequate light is crucial for your Hydrangea 'Pinky Winky' to produce robust blooms. These beauties typically flower from mid-summer to fall, showcasing their vibrant colors when given the right light conditions.

🚫 Signs of Insufficient Light

If your plant isn't getting enough light, you'll notice some telltale signs. Look out for stunted growth, fewer blooms, and leggy stems that stretch toward the light.

πŸ”§ Adjustments Needed

To remedy insufficient light, consider increasing exposure or relocating your plant to a brighter spot. Small adjustments can make a big difference in your hydrangea's health and flowering potential.

Using Grow Lights

🌟 Benefits of Grow Lights

Grow lights are a game changer for plant enthusiasts. They provide consistent light levels year-round, ensuring your Hydrangea 'Pinky Winky' thrives even when natural sunlight is scarce.

In winter months, when daylight is limited, grow lights can help overcome seasonal light deficiencies. This means your plants can continue to flourish, regardless of the weather outside.

πŸ’‘ Types of Grow Lights

When it comes to grow lights, there are a couple of standout options. LED grow lights are energy-efficient and offer an adjustable spectrum, making them versatile for various growth stages.

On the other hand, fluorescent lights are excellent for seedlings and young plants. They provide a softer light that’s gentle yet effective for nurturing new growth.

πŸ“ Placement and Duration

For optimal results, place your grow lights 12-24 inches above your plants. This distance allows for adequate light distribution without causing stress to your Hydrangea.

Aim for a light duration of 12-16 hours per day. This schedule mimics natural sunlight and supports healthy growth.
